Moreover, Joe has been a seemingly unstoppable murderer for four seasons of the television series You, which is based on the Caroline Kepnes novel series. His pursuit of Guinevere Beck (Elizabeth Lail), whom he first became fixated on in Season 1, has since evolved into a succession of obsessions, with him killing everybody who stands in his way of getting any closer to his intended victim. In Season 3, he wed the chef Love Quinn (Victoria Pedretti), who had her own dark secrets. Nevertheless, he reverted to his old ways by chasing Marienne (Tati Gabrielle), and in the end killed Love after her effort to finally get him. He recently adopted the name Professor Jonathan Moore in an effort to fit in with London’s intellectual community during Season 4, but he soon became fixated once again and had to face the “Eat the Rich” killer, who wasn’t quite who spectators had first assumed. Changing Joe’s perspective in Part 1 of the season was a big risk, but it paid off handsomely in terms of both viewership and critical acclaim, especially with Part 2.

You Season 5: Is it really happening?
Sera Gamble, who is also the creator of the series, has been considering a Season 5 for a while. She revealed that she, the writing staff, and co-creator Greg Berlanti were already considering alternatives for how to follow up the enormous new season after the publication of Season 4 Part 1. She also mentioned working toward the ultimate objective of successfully prosecuting Joe. In an effort to prevent the show from growing old, Badgley said that Season 5 would be the last.
